Judge Rejects Sean Kingston’s Mother’s Bid To Be Sentenced On The Same Day As Her Son In $1 Million Luxury Fraud Case
According to All Hip-Hop, Janice Turner hoped to share the spotlight—and the consequences—on sentencing day with her son, Sean Kingston. But a Florida judge isn’t allowing it.
U.S. District Judge David S. Leibowitz denied Turner’s request to be sentenced on August 15, the same day Kingston will learn his fate in their high-profile fraud case.
Despite no objection from prosecutors or the probation office, the judge refused her unopposed motion to simply be sentenced earlier that same day.
Her hearing remains locked in for July 11 at 9 a.m.
Turner, 61, was convicted in March of helping orchestrate a scheme with Kingston to scam luxury vendors using fake wire transfers and forged documents.
They scored high-end items like a $285K jewelry order, a $160K Escalade, and even an $86K luxury bed—all under the guise of Kingston’s fame.
She’s in custody; Kingston remains on house arrest.
